Commit 7ac1413c authored by Lucien Gentis's avatar Lucien Gentis
Browse files

XML updates.


git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/branches/2.4.x@1839437 13f79535-47bb-0310-9956-ffa450edef68
parent c5f92105
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d">
<?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
<!-- English Revision: 1834777 -->
<!-- English Revision: 1838466 -->
<!-- French translation : Lucien GENTIS -->
<!-- Reviewed by : Vincent Deffontaines -->

@@ -2189,7 +2189,7 @@ host</context>

<highlight language="config">
&lt;FilesMatch "^(?&lt;sitename&gt;[^/]+)"&gt;
    require ldap-group cn=%{env:MATCH_SITENAME},ou=combined,o=Example
    Require ldap-group cn=%{env:MATCH_SITENAME},ou=combined,o=Example
&lt;/FilesMatch&gt;
</highlight>

@@ -3437,7 +3437,7 @@ host</context>

<highlight language="config">
&lt;LocationMatch "^/combined/(?&lt;sitename&gt;[^/]+)"&gt;
    require ldap-group cn=%{env:MATCH_SITENAME},ou=combined,o=Example
    Require ldap-group cn=%{env:MATCH_SITENAME},ou=combined,o=Example
&lt;/LocationMatch&gt;
</highlight>

+2 −2
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d">
<?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
<!-- English Revision : 1437838 -->
<!-- English Revision : 1839246 -->
<!-- French translation : Lucien GENTIS -->
<!-- Reviewed by : Vincent Deffontaines -->

+3 −3
Original line number Diff line number Diff line
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d">
<?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
<!-- English Revision: 1832295 -->
<!-- English Revision: 1838953 -->
<!-- French translation : Lucien GENTIS -->
<!-- Reviewed by : Vincent Deffontaines -->

@@ -247,6 +247,7 @@ ProxyPass "/apps" "balancer://foo"
serveur, du jeu de threads utilisé pour le check up des
équipiers</description>
<syntax>ProxyHCTPsize <em>size</em></syntax>
<default>ProxyHCTPsize 16</default>
<contextlist><context>server config</context>
</contextlist>

@@ -257,8 +258,7 @@ serveur, du jeu de threads utilisé pour le check up des
    directive <directive>ProxyHCTPsize</directive> permet de déterminer la
    taille de ce jeu de threads. Une valeur de <code>0</code> signifie qu'aucun
    jeu de threads ne sera utilisé, et le check up des différents équipiers sera
    alors effectué séquentiellement. La taille par défaut du jeu de threads est
    de 16.</p>
    alors effectué séquentiellement.</p>

    <example><title>ProxyHCTPsize</title>
    <highlight language="config">
+18 −16
Original line number Diff line number Diff line
<?xml version="1.0"?>
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d">
<?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?>
<!-- English Revision : 1231443 -->
<!-- English Revision : 1839254 -->
<!-- French translation : Lucien GENTIS -->
<!-- Reviewed by : Vincent Deffontaines -->

@@ -24,43 +24,45 @@

<modulesynopsis metafile="mod_watchdog.xml.meta">
<name>mod_watchdog</name>
<description>Fournit une infrastructure permettant &agrave; d'autres modules
d'ex&eacute;cuter des t&acirc;ches p&eacute;riodiques.</description>
<description>Fournit une infrastructure permettant à d'autres modules
d'exécuter des tâches périodiques.</description>
<status>Base</status>
<sourcefile>mod_watchdog.c</sourcefile>
<identifier>watchdog_module</identifier>
<compatibility>Disponible &agrave; partir de la version 2.3 du serveur HTTP
<compatibility>Disponible à partir de la version 2.3 du serveur HTTP
Apache</compatibility>

<summary>
<p>Le module <module>mod_watchdog</module> d&eacute;finit des
branchements (hooks) programm&eacute;s pour permettre &agrave; d'autres modules
d'ex&eacute;cuter des t&acirc;ches p&eacute;riodiques. Ces modules peuvent enregistrer des
<p>Le module <module>mod_watchdog</module> définit des
branchements (hooks) programmés pour permettre à d'autres modules
d'exécuter des tâches périodiques. Ces modules peuvent enregistrer des
gestionnaires (handlers) pour les branchements de
<module>mod_watchdog</module>. Actuellement, seuls les modules suivants
de la distribution Apache utilisent cette fonctionnalit&eacute; :</p>
de la distribution Apache utilisent cette fonctionnalité :</p>
<ul>
<li><module>mod_heartbeat</module></li>
<li><module>mod_heartmonitor</module></li>
<li><module>mod_md</module></li>
<li><module>mod_proxy_hcheck</module></li>
</ul>
<note type="warning">
Pour qu'un module puisse utiliser la fonctionnalit&eacute; de
<module>mod_watchdog</module>, ce dernier doit &ecirc;tre li&eacute; statiquement
avec le serveur httpd ; s'il a &eacute;t&eacute; li&eacute; dynamiquement, il doit &ecirc;tre
charg&eacute; avant l'appel au module qui doit utiliser sa fonctionnalit&eacute;.
Pour qu'un module puisse utiliser la fonctionnalité de
<module>mod_watchdog</module>, ce dernier doit être lié statiquement
avec le serveur httpd ; s'il a été lié dynamiquement, il doit être
chargé avant l'appel au module qui doit utiliser sa fonctionnalité.
</note>
</summary>

<directivesynopsis>
<name>WatchdogInterval</name>
<description>Intervalle Watchdog en secondes</description>
<syntax>WatchdogInterval <var>number-of-seconds</var></syntax>
<syntax>WatchdogInterval <var>time-interval</var>[s]</syntax>
<default>WatchdogInterval 1</default>
<contextlist><context>server config</context></contextlist>

<usage>
<p>Cette directive permet de d&eacute;finir l'intervalle entre chaque ex&eacute;cution
du branchement watchdog. La valeur par d&eacute;faut est de 1 seconde.</p>
<p>Cette directive permet de définir l'intervalle entre chaque exécution
du branchement watchdog. La valeur par défaut est de 1 seconde.</p>
</usage>
</directivesynopsis>
</modulesynopsis>
+20 −24
Original line number Diff line number Diff line
@@ -3,7 +3,7 @@
<?xml-stylesheet type="text/xsl" href="./style/manual.fr.xsl"?>
<!-- French translation : Lucien GENTIS -->
<!-- Reviewed by : Vincent Deffontaines -->
<!-- English Revision: 1823764 -->
<!-- English Revision: 1838946 -->

<!--
 Licensed to the Apache Software Foundation (ASF) under one or more
@@ -412,20 +412,17 @@ toutes les requêtes sans tenir compte de l'URL spécifique.</p>

<section id="nesting"><title>Imbrication des sections</title>

<p>Certains types de sections peuvent être imbriqués : d'une part, on
peut utiliser les sections <directive type="section"
module="core">Files</directive> à l'intérieur des sections <directive
type="section" module="core">Directory</directive>, d'autre part, on
peut utiliser les
directives <directive type="section" module="core">If</directive> à
l'intérieur des sections <directive type="section"
module="core">Directory</directive>, <directive type="section"
module="core">Location</directive> et <directive type="section"
module="core">Files</directive> (mais pas à l'intérieur d'une autre section
<directive type="section" module="core">If</directive>). Les valeurs des
expressions
rationnelles correspondant aux sections nommées se comportent de manière
identique.</p>
<p>Certains types de sections peuvent être imbriqués : d'une part, on peut
utiliser les sections <directive type="section" module="core">Files</directive>
à l'intérieur des sections <directive type="section"
module="core">Directory</directive>, d'autre part, on peut utiliser les
directives <directive type="section" module="core">If</directive> à l'intérieur
des sections <directive type="section" module="core">Directory</directive>,
<directive type="section" module="core">Location</directive> et <directive
type="section" module="core">Files</directive> (mais pas à l'intérieur d'une
autre section <directive type="section" module="core">If</directive>). Les
valeurs des expressions rationnelles correspondant aux sections nommées se
comportent de manière identique.</p>

<p>Les sections imbriquées sont fusionnées après les sections
non-imbriquées de même type.</p>
@@ -454,7 +451,7 @@ sites qui correspondent à l'URL spécifiée et auxquels on a
accédé via le serveur mandataire du module <module>mod_proxy</module>.
Par exemple, la configuration suivante n'autorisera qu'un sous-ensemble de
clients à accéder au site <code>www.example.com</code> en passant par le serveur
mandataire :</p>
mandataire :.</p>

<highlight language="config">
&lt;Proxy "http://www.example.com/*"&gt;
@@ -541,7 +538,7 @@ sont interprétées.</p>
    module="core">Directory</directive>, dans chaque groupe, les sections sont
    traitées selon
    l'ordre dans lequel elles apparaissent dans les fichiers de configuration.
    Par exemple, une requête pour <em>/foo</em> correspondra à
    Par exemple, une requête pour <em>/foo/bar</em> correspondra à
    <code>&lt;Location "/foo/bar"&gt;</code> et <code>&lt;Location
    "/foo"&gt;</code> (dans ce cas le groupe 4) : les deux sections seront
    évaluées mais selon l'ordre dans lequel elles apparaissent dans le fichier
@@ -572,7 +569,6 @@ sont interprétées.</p>
    type="section">Directory</directive> dans l'ordre de traitement.</li>
    </ul>

    
	<note><title>Note technique</title>
	Une séquence <code>&lt;Location&gt;</code>/<code>&lt;LocationMatch&gt;</code>
	est réellement traitée juste avant la phase de traduction du nom